So when we get back into the scripture in First Corinthians one twenty six to thirty one, it starts off by saying, for you see your calling, brethren, that not many wise according to the flesh, not many mighty, not many nobles are called. What I love about that is because first of all, wisdom brings direction. The Bible tells us that wisdom is profitable to direct. So whether it is the wisdom of God, there is a directive for your life, and it has to do in the thing that God has called you to. You see, there's an information that God will reveal to you, and our problem is that we want it to make sense. We want everything to It is the idol of acceptance in our hearts. It is the idol of liability amongst our peers that prevents us from hearing the voice of God. There are many things that God wants to get to you, but it goes through the filters of your idols in the heart. This will make me look crazy. God, I don't want to do this because, oh my God, that sounds fool But then the Lord is talking about how he uses the foolish things of the world to confound the wise. Because if the Lord is giving you an assignment that makes sense to you, you will glory in yourself. You would say, oh, yeah, I understand why God will call me to do this. That makes absolute sense. And so the Lord has He has this pattern of calling you not according to your abilities, but according to his So anytime you find yourself in a situation where you're like, but God, you know I don't have the resources for this. I don't have the relationships for this. I don't have the wisdom for this. You are the perfect candidate for the job. Do you know? The first time God is angry in the Bible, the first time that the Bible reveals something that angered God, it was in response to Moses' question in God about why he's not the one to be used. Because every time you put yourself in a position to say, God, it's not me because I don't have fill in the blank, it is offensive to God because you're trying to tell him that the only reason he chose you is because of you, that he has no parts to play. It is offensive to him. So the first time we see God an expression of anger from God, it's when he's telling Moses his assignment and Moses is trying to reason himself out of it. He's like, but I can't speak, and he's talking to the one who created him, and he goes down this list. I don't know what your list looks like, but he goes down this list about all the reasons why he couldn't do what God was calling him to do, and the Bible tells us, and the anger of God was kindled against Moses. You will think the first time God got angry when when you're learned about the Bible, you will think it's the flood, right, God wipes out the earth, you know, except the family and all the animals, right well too of each kind. But you will think, oh, God was angry. He wasn't angry. The Bible says, yea, I was actually sorrowful. But when we see God angry for the first time, it was his anger was in response to humanity, saying they could not do what he spoke to them about because they didn't see it in themselves. When I think about a fool's journey, I see it all over the Bible. God encounters the man named Abraham and he says, Abraham, leave everything, leave your family, leave everything, and come to a land I would show you, Abraham, I would be your GPS. Now in a room full of people that could have control issues, we're driving, you say, God, you just want me to follow you, and I don't even know where I'm going. That looks foolish in the moment. You know what sounds crazy. It's when Mary is encountered by an angel and she's told a spirit will get you pregnant. You see, as believers, we're like, yes, oh, baby, Jee's resurrection, all the things, Easter, we get excited, Christmas, all the things right. But imagine an atheist when they hear the story. So you're telling me the woman as someone told her a spirit will get her pregnant with her creator, and she just said, let it be unto me as you will. Do you know how foolish that sounds. She's no one has ever experienced such a thing and she's just there having this nice poetic moment. Let it be onto me. Then you go to the life of Noah. You have a man who has never seen rain, and he is told to build an arc that there would be a flood, and they have never seen rain. Noah spense, He invests one hundred and twenty years of his life in building something he had no evidence for except the word. And you have to realize that because when we think about the story of Noah, we wonder, you know, but why why why did the people just you know, they were laughing at him. Of course they laughed at him. It sounded foolish. And the people they had boats because there was there was an ocean, so they're like, look, if we need something to float, and we could, we could float and survive. We have our own boats. But they had they had no There was no reference for a flood, There was no reference for what the Word of God was saying. But for one hundred and twenty years of his life it was committed to building something on the strength of a word. Now, Noah lived to nine hundred and fifty years, so a little bit over ten percent of his life was dedicated to this and in our generation, let's just say you live up to ninety right, ten percent of that is ninety years. We do something for two years and don't see evidence. We start complaining, God, did you really say you see? It's not just about giving God your tithe with your finances. Can you tithe your life? Can God? Can you give God ten percent of your life to build something and not have evidence for it only because he said it to you? Six months we do something and we don't see the fruit, and we're just panicking. But who spoke it? You see? The strength of a fool's journey is in his intimacy with the Lord, is in her intimacy with the Lord. I'm not talking about hope. I'm talking about faith. I'm not talking about the things that you want to create out of your own mind. The Bible says that we walk by faith, not by sight. And there is a difference between faith and hope because faith is marked the right by a revelation of God's word. Hope is marked by your expectation and God is not obligated to meet it because what could feed your expectation could be corrupted. Sometimes what feeds your expectation could be your pride. It could be ego, it could be jealousy, it could be envy. I'm not talking about that. I'm talking about when the Lord gives you a word. But then we are canceling out our own selves because it doesn't make sense, not realizing that if you are gonna walk in the wisdom of God their moments, it will require you to look like a fool. Do you know that before I became a minister, I was very I was in real estate and I had no desire for ministry and I had this path played out in my mind. I was flipping properties at the time. I was making incredible money and I was like, you know what, and plus flipping, I should become an agent. I'm like, oh, this is money. Both ways, I was young and I was just having a time. I remember one time I called my mom. She's like, what are you doing. I said, oh, I'm going to the Rolex store. You know, I'm about to go get me a nice watch. She said, Stephan, you don't have problem. Do you know how many people in Nigeria are suffering? She said the way my mom almost cursed me out. I said, Mom, you know what, you are killing my vibe. He said, if you don't know what to do with money, send it to me. And I was like, maybe I'm mean irresponsible. I mean not by the watch. But during that time I was I was enjoying myself. My brother and I we were My mom used to get so frustrated. She's like, you people don't know what to do with money. Because my brother you call him, he's in Miami. Then he's at a Laker game, and then we're like, let's just meet somewhere. We were just enjoying ourselves, right, But in the midst of that, I remember the moment where I could feel God was far from me, and I was like, no, something is wrong. I didn't have There was nothing I could articulate that I I had need of in that time. But something was wrong with my alignment. And I wasn't doing anything like crazy in an evil way. I was just living my life right. But something was off with my relationship with the Lord. And I went on the fast. I said, God, this, this doesn't feel right, This doesn't sut you. You feel far from me. And I went on the fast and I said, Lord, show me if there is anything I am doing that is displeasing to you, if there is anything that I'm doing that is not in alignment with what you know concerning me. Now, I didn't have I didn't want to be a pastor, but the Lord became my father. At nine years old. That was when I first encountered the Lord and so I grew up with him as I always called him Dad. Even til now there are times in my prayer I'm like, Daddy, this is what's happening. Right. But I knew him as Dad, I knew his voice in my life, and so when I felt him far from me, that was different. I said no. And at this point I had I had also received him as savior, which took me a couple of years, but I received him as savior as well as father. And I said something, something does not feel right. And when I I went on a fast and I said, God, you've shown me because I could be living one way, thinking I'm doing amazing, and in your books you have this is not even written in your books. I'm not even close to what you wrote concerning me. And it was during that fast that changed my life because I came out of that fast and the Lord says, I want you to walk away from real estate. I want you to walk away from everything, your security. And he wasn't calling me to walk away from it forever, but in that moment, the instruction was walk away from it because I had put my identity in money. He said, your security is your finances and anything that is your security outside of God is God to you. If it's a person, if it is money. Whatever you find safety in outside of Christ is a God in your life, even though you don't call it that. He says, your safety is in your finances. I'm gonna strip you off it, but you need to agree. It wasn't that things got chaotic and the business went bad. No business was thriving. I was twenty three at the time of twenty two, twenty three, and I was doing great. He says, no, you would have to agree. This would require your consent, and he says walk away from everything. And I did because it was more important to me now and then that I was close to my dad, then closer to the pleasures of this world and far from him. I didn't want his spirit far from me. And he didn't even tell me exactly what was gonna happen. He just said, I want you to walk away from it all. I want you to move to this city, and I'll give you the next instructions when you move. Talk about foolishness. It was absurd to my family because you don't even have a plan. I was living off savings without a plan, but I knew a voice when the voice of God is in your life, that is your safety. It's not your resources, it's not your relationships, it's not what you know, it's not who you can call. It is knowing that the creator of all is the one that you can call on. He is your safety, and that becomes the strength in your life that even when you look like a fool, it doesn't mean it will not hurt. I had many nights I cried because I was so confused about the journey God had me on. But every time he would encounter me, he says, I am with you. If you stay the course, then you will see my hand in it all. I could have chosen to say, nah, that's crazy, that's foolish, and I will not be here in front of you, because that was the path that led me to the revealing that who He had called me to be was a minister of the gospel.
